May 2009 RES Update
Topics in this month's edition include information on state housing finance agencies programs to provide bridge loans to first-time home buyers eligible for the credit, expansion of the Making Home Affordable program to permit modification of second mortgages, NAR's calls for delaying implementation of HVCC and information on the "American Clean Energy and Security Act", among other topics.

Jumbo Mortgage Market is Holding Recovery Back, Realtors® Report 
Limited availability and unusually high interest rates in the jumbo loan market are adversely affecting the rest of the housing market. This is just one of the insights from recent NAR research on the Impact of the Jumbo Mortgage Credit Crunch, released today at the Realtors® Midyear Legislative Meetings & Trade Expo.
